The video tutorial explains how to condense multiple logarithmic expressions into a single expression using the product rule. It demonstrates the process of applying the product rule to combine logarithms, followed by expanding and simplifying the expression using the FOIL method. The tutorial concludes with the final expression in both condensed and expanded forms.
